Ultra precise & Versatile IEEE-1588 Grand Master

 

 

Innos's Stratum 1 level SGPS-MP provides the complete end-to-end sync solution for your local ethernet network.

 

By using an integrated, 12-channel GPS receiver, every visible satellite can be tracked and used to maintain accurate and reliable time. Even in urban canyon environments where satellite visibility can be limited, the automatic, single satellite tracking mode provides accurate time from as few as on intermittent satellite.

The IEEE 1588 protocol enables very accurate synchronization over Ethernet LANs and offers the ability to synchronize clocks to better than 1us accuracy with only a network connection.

Ultra Miniature IEEE-1588 PTP Slave

 

 

INNOS's IEEE-1588 Slave Module MPM-C163 derives accurate Timing without Ethernet MAC/PHY.

 

The IEEE 1588 protocol enables very accurate synchronization over MII interface and offers the ability to synchronize clocks high accuracy with only a network connection. MPM-C163 slave measures time through network elements such as switches or through custom network topologies.

PTP Slave provides the precise time and is also equipped to physically measure how well that time is transferred through the network with precision down to 10 ns resolution. MPM-C 163 does not have MAC/PHY interface , so does not need extra IP address. The MPM-C163 is a small size timing reference unit that provides highly accurate timing and frequency output signals synchronized to UTC(Universal Time Coordinated).

The MPM-C163 PTP Slave supports a wide variety of time and frequency.You can communicate via the debug port for monitoring.

A Comprehensive RS-232 command set provides versatile control of the MPM-C163.

Ultra Miniature IEEE-1588 Master/Slave Module

 

 

INNOS's Stratum 1 level MMM-O161 derives accurate time directly It support IEEE-1588 Master or slave function

 

By using an integrated, 50-channel GPS receiver, every visible satellite can be tracked and used to maintain accurate and reliable time. Even in urban canyon environments where satellite visibility can be limited, the automatic, single satellite tracking mode provides accurate time from as few as on intermittent satellite.

The IEEE 1588 protocol enables very accurate synchronization over MII interface and offers the ability to synchronize clocks high accuracy with only a network connection. The MMM-O161 does not have MAC/PHY interface , so does not need extra IP address. The MMM-O161 is a small size timing reference unit that provides highly accurate timing and frequency output signals synchronized to UTC(Universal Time Coordinated).

The MMM-O161 operate as IEEE-1588 Master or slave . A Comprehensive RS-232 command set provides versatile control of the MMM-O161.
